American drivers are likely to pay a little less for gas this year and President Donald Trump is happy to take credit. The projected $2.70 a gallon pump price for 2019 is 3 cents lower than 2018 levels, although this year’s high could reach $3 as soon as May and top $4 in some cities, according to GasBuddy’s Price Fuel Outlook. The lower prices have not escaped Trump’s attention, who equated them to a tax cut in a tweet. While overall prices are set to decline, drivers should brace for a rocky ride. Continued Opec production cuts and a strong US economy would push prices higher in the spring while an economic slowdown or lower demand could reduce prices, wrote Patrick DeHaan, head of petroleum analysis at GasBuddy.
